does not seem to understand it in the least.  M went to call on Ayesha and took James with her.  Prior and
             Parke came to dinner and afterwards I went down the town with them to look on at some of the Matems
             where they have the special Muharram preachers.  It seemed to me rather a poorer show than last year,
             people are all so poor this year that they have not been able to hire such good men.  We didnt stay very long
             and the most interesting part is later on when they get worked up, that we missed.  The procession at night
             through the narrow streets with people carrying torches and all the queer sort of symbolical biers and things
             looks very effective.  Had a great many very nasty sweet drinks which made me feel rather sick.  Some of the
             old Matems are very like old country churches with pillars and arches and in some cases carved wooden
             pillars which are very handsome.  The preacher sits on a high sort of throne in the centre and the people sit
             on the floor, on mats, all round, during part of the time they can smoke and drink coffee but later on this is
             not done.  There was a lot of fuss about some of the people using some of the musical instruments belonging
             to the school for the procession, the ones who had not thought of it were very angry and said they would
             smash them if they appeared.



             Sunday 19th Muharram [8 June]

             Went to the big show, the procession, in the morning with M and Dr Tiffany, neither of them had ever seen
             it.  As usual it was very late beginning.  I put them on the top of a roof and then waited in the Municipal
             offices till it started.  It was a far smaller show than usual mainly as the Persians dont come here in such
             numbers now a days.  I found I had fever when I got back so retired to bed for the rest of the day.  I had a bad
             foot, a mosquito bite gone wrong which was the cause, felt quite ill and stayed in bed.

             Tuesday [10 June]

             Office, felt rather limp.  A violent shamaal wind, they say that the Bara wind started on Sunday, it is supposed
             to last for about 40 days.  Rashid bin Mohamed called about the house, he is the Shaikh's wife's father, he
             was very violent about it and said they would do anything to prevent the other side from getting it.  My
             sympathies are with him as the others are always against Shaikh Hamed and one of them is the poisonous
             relation who tried to murder him.  Went to the Customs.  Our tennis court is getting very broken up, such a
             nuisance.  Had tea at the Mission but did not play tennis.  Down mail in.  Drove to Rafaa.  There is a rice boat
             in from Calcutta which is bringing us a good deal of revenue.  Decidedly limp after having fever, I had a
             temperature of 103.  My foot is practically recovered.
